Fluke IRR2-BT Solar Site Survey Irradiance Meter

The Fluke IRR2-BT Solar Site Survey Irradiance Meter is ideal for critical measurements that are needed for installing, testing, maintaining and reporting on solar panels and photovoltaic systems with one simple to use tool.

The IRR2-BT allows for the measurement of irradiance up to 1400 W/m2, temperature (-30 °C to 100 °C), inclination (-90° to +90°) and solar array direction. The rugged and and compact deign of the meter alongside the easy to read LCD screen allowing for data to be viewed even in direct sunlight allowing for site surveys to be conducted even in tough working conditions. Instant solar irradiation measurements and the built in temperature sensor meet IEC 62446-1 testing requirements providing the watt per square meter solar irradiation.

The IRR2-BT boasts an integrated compass and inclination sensor allowing the user to quickly measure and document the roof and site orientation, pitch and panel tilt when conducting surveys, installing or adjusting installations.

The IRR2-BT features wireless connection allowing for any recorded irradiance or temperature measurements with the Fluke SMFT-1000 Solar PV Multifunction Tester and I-V Curve Tracer to instantly determine the I-V curve of any panels under test.

The Fluke IRR2-BT is battery powered using four AA batteries that provide ups to 50 hours usage (9000 readings). Battery life is preserved using the Auto power off function after 30 minutes of inactivity. The IRR2-BT also includes a mounting bracket for accurate irradiance and temperature readings at the panel.

Specification

Irradiance

  • Measuring range: 50 to 1400 W/m2
  • Resolution: 1 W/m2
  • Measuring accuracy: ±(5 % + 5 Digit)

Temperature Measurement

  • Measuring range: -30 °C to 100 °C (-22 °F to 212 °F)
  • Resolution; 0.1 °C (0.2 °F / 1 °F @ > 100 °F)
  • Measuring accuracy:
    ±1 °C (±2 °F) @ -10 °C to 75 °C (14 °F to 167 °F)
    ±2 °C (±4 °F) @ -30 °C to -10 °C (-22 °F to 14 °F)
    75 °C to 100 °C (167 °F to 212 °F)
  • Temperature measurement response time: ~30 seconds

Inclination Angle

  • Measuring range: -90º–C to 90ºC
  • Resolution: 0.1º
  • Measuring accuracy
    ±1.5° @ -50° to +50°
    ±2.5° @ -85° to -50° and +50° to +85°
    ±3.5° @ -90° to -85° and +85° to +90°
  • Inclination accuracy is specified as the angle between a vertical and the absolute horizontal plane/true horizontal baseline. The Product is calibrated to true horizontal 0°.

Compass

  • Measuring range: 0º to 360º
  • Resolution: 1º
  • Measuring accuracy: ±7°
  • Measurements valid for device inclination between -20° and +20° to horizontal. Outside that range, --- shows on the LCD. Result is in reference to magnetic north
